Jessica Biel can't stop the feeling that comes with these throwback pictures.
The actress recently posted a collection of photos taken more than 20 years ago, back when she was one of the lead stars of 7th Heaven and a talent to watch in Hollywood.
In one of the images, taken on the red carpet for the 1999 premiere of American Pie, Jessica is seen wearing an ombre tank top and cropped black pants. She also shared a photo from the 1998 premiere of Playing by Heart, where she sported a black graphic tee, leather jacket and multicolored beanie to the event.
"I hear all of these outfits are cool again," Jessica captioned her April 17 slideshow. "Love that for me because I was worried they were questionable the first time."
Justin Timberlake, who met Jessica in 2007 and married her in 2012, had nothing but heart eyes for the photos, writing in the comments, "The teenage me just started sweating."
The pair—who are parents to sons Phineas, 2, and Silas, 8—have kept their relationship going strong throughout the years, with Justin always taking time to celebrate his wife. Just last month, he penned a sweet tribute on Jessica's 41st birthday, adding that she was "aging like a FINE wine!!!!"
"Let me tell y'all about this human… she is the most badass, most graceful, most gorgeous DREAM of a partner I could have ever wished for," the singer wrote on Instagram. "And today is her bday! I'm so glad you were born, my love. And, I'm so lucky that you are choosing to do this thing called life with me. I love you to the moon and back."

The couple has mastered the red carpet, slaying their 2018 Golden Globes arrival.
The pair switched up their looks for something more casual after the 2018 Golden Globes.
Jessica turned heads in the bright yellow gown as she was accompanied by Justin on a night out.
The duo stunned on the red carpet of the 2018 Emmy Awards.
Exactly 10 years after first meeting at the 2007 Golden Globes, they walked the red carpet looking more in love than ever.
Red carpet royalty! The couple enjoyed a major style moment at the 2017 Oscars.
The actress got her groove on during a night out with Timberlake at a Los Angeles Lakers game in early 2017.
Name a more iconic Hollywood duo, we dare you.
Can't stop the feeling! The trio dressed up as the characters from the movie Trolls for Halloween in 2016.
The "What Goes Around" crooner supported his No. 1 as she accepted the Inspiration Award onstage during the 2015 GLSEN Respect Awards.
In 2014, it was revealed that the longtime duo was expecting their very first child together. Silas Randall Timberlake was born in April 2015!
The lovely duo wore matching suits as they attended the world premiere of Timberlake's Runner Runner flack in Las Vegas.
2013 proved quite a year for these two: The lovebirds were all smiles on their way to watch the Broadway show The Book of Mormon in the Big Apple.
Fast forward to 2013, and the married couple looked stunning at the Premiere of Inside Llewyn Davis at the 66th Annual Cannes Film Festival in France.
The actres is giving her hubby a kiss and he's loving it at the 2013 US Open in NY.
It's official, y'all! Justin Timberlake and Jessica Biel said "I do" in southern Italy on October 19, 2012. "It's great to be married, the ceremony was beautiful and it was so special to be surrounded by our family and friends," the duo told People.
Jess was happy to cheer on her athletically-inclined man at a pre-wedding golf tournament in 2012.
Ooh, la la! The normally reserved couple packed on the PDA for the famed Kiss Cam at a Los Angeles Lakers game in May 2012.
Over the 2011 holiday season, the former boybander popped the question with a stunning engagement ring. Who ultimately spilled the engagement beans? Justin's granny, who let the cat out of the bag to a gossip blog.
Even though they were technically broken up, Justin couldn't help gushing about J.Biel in an interview with Vanity Fair in the summer of 2011. "She is the single-handedly most significant person in my life," he said. By the fall, Justin and Jessica were back on.
Say it ain't so! On Mar. 11, 2011, the couple released a joint statement to People confirming that they had, in fact, broken up.
On Feb. 27, 2011, the A-list duo literally sparkled at Vanity Fair's Oscars after-party. Timberlake's film The Social Network received eight Academy Award nominations that night and went home with three.
The lovebirds took a low-key stroll holding hands through NYC's Tribeca neighborhood in 2010.
In May 2009, the perfect pair embodied old-school Hollywood glamour at the Met Costume Institute Gala in NYC.
J.T. and Jess first struck up a conversation at the 2007 Golden Globes afterparty, according to reports.The night was likely a bit awkward as Justin's recent ex-girlfriend Cameron Diaz was also in attendance.
